Detailed Comparison

Harvey AI vs Lighthouse: Trust & Compliance Comparison

Harvey AI (Harvey AI, Inc., US) scores 17/25 overall with a Silver (Strong) trust badge. AI assistant built for legal professionals. Lighthouse (Lighthouse, BE) scores 20/25 with a Silver (Strong) trust badge. AI revenue management and business intelligence for hospitality and travel.

Dimension-by-Dimension Breakdown

#### Data Residency

Lighthouse leads with 4/5 vs 3/5.

Harvey AI (3/5): US/EU hosting via Azure
Lighthouse (4/5): Data hosted on AWS with EU region configuration for European customers. Belgian incorporation means primary data governance is under EU law. Appropriate for European hotel groups with GDPR obligations on guest and revenue data.

#### Legal Jurisdiction

Lighthouse leads with 5/5 vs 2/5.

Harvey AI (2/5): US Delaware corporation
Lighthouse (5/5): Incorporated in Belgium under Belgian and EU law. GDPR applies as a matter of corporate law, not just contractual obligation. EU incorporation with no US parent company. No CLOUD Act exposure. Strong EU sovereignty story for the hospitality sector.

#### Data Retention & Training

Both score equally at 4/5.

Harvey AI (4/5): No training on client data; strict data isolation
Lighthouse (4/5): Customer hotel data is not used for cross-customer model training without consent. GDPR-compliant data processing agreements available under Article 28. Configurable data retention aligned with hospitality operational requirements.

#### Certifications

Harvey AI leads with 4/5 vs 3/5.

Harvey AI (4/5): SOC 2 Type II, ISO 27001
Lighthouse (3/5): Holds ISO 27001 certification. Appropriate baseline for a hospitality technology platform. SOC 2 Type II would strengthen the posture for hotel groups with enterprise procurement requirements.

#### Regulatory Fit

Both score equally at 4/5.

Harvey AI (4/5): SRA-suitable; used by Magic Circle and elite law firms
Lighthouse (4/5): Excellent fit for European hotel operators subject to GDPR and national data protection authorities. Belgian legal jurisdiction and EU data hosting provide a credible compliance posture. Good alignment with hospitality-specific data governance requirements.
